We propose a generic algorithm for the construction of efficient reversible variable-length codes (RVLCs) and variablelength error-correcting (VLEC) codes, which optimizes the codeword length distribution. The algorithm may be applied to any existing codeword selection mechanism, and it is capable of generating codes of higher efficiency in comparison to the algorithms disseminated in the literature. Index Terms—Code design, free distance, Huffman codes, reversibile variable length codes (RVLCs), variable length error correcting (VLEC) codes.
展开▼